Geoffrey Hamlyn

Geoffrey Hamlyn is a violist based in Portland, Oregon, where he has lived since 2021. He studied at the Juilliard School with Heidi Castleman and the University of Texas with Roger Myers. His festival appearances include Sarasota, Taos, Music Academy of the West, and Prussia Cove. He is also a member of the Vancouver Symphony Orchestra.
Beyond music, Geoffrey has built a career in nonprofit leadership and business management. He has served as Chief Operating Officer of a national consulting firm, Executive Director of a nonprofit organization, and as a leader on several nonprofit boards. He holds a Master of Public Policy from Duke University and currently serves as a Strategic Advisor to Trepwise, a strategy consulting firm.
Originally from El Paso, Texas, Geoffrey grew up in a family of musicians. He met his husband, Stephen, while they were both studying at Juilliard more than 20 years ago. Family remains at the center of his life, and when he isn’t working or playing viola, Geoffrey can often be found gardening or exploring Portland with his beloved rough collie, Leia.
